2-Day Amsterdam Adventure: Museums, Canals, and Culinary Delights

Day 1: Culture and Canals

Amsterdam, Netherlands on April 19, 2025

8:30am

Breakfast at Pancakes Amsterdam

Start your day with traditional Dutch pancakes at Pancakes Amsterdam near Centraal Station, offering a wide variety of sweet and savory options to fuel your morning.
EUR10, 1h

9:45am

Rijksmuseum Visit

Explore the Rijksmuseum's impressive collection of Dutch art and history, including masterpieces by Rembrandt and Vermeer, open daily from 9am to 5pm.
EUR20, 2h30m

12:30pm

Lunch at Café Loetje

Enjoy a classic Dutch steak sandwich at Café Loetje, known for its cozy atmosphere and high-quality, local ingredients.
EUR25, 1h

1:45pm

Van Gogh Museum

Visit the Van Gogh Museum to see the world's largest collection of Van Gogh’s works; open 9am-6pm, this is a highlight of Amsterdam’s art scene.
EUR19, 1h30m

3:30pm

Canal Cruise

Enjoy a scenic 1-hour canal cruise to experience Amsterdam’s iconic waterways from a unique perspective. Cruises usually run until early evening.
EUR20, 1h

5:00pm

Walk through Jordaan District

Take a relaxing walk through the charming streets of the Jordaan District with its quaint shops and cafés, perfect for an early evening stroll.
Free, 1h

7:00pm

Dinner at Restaurant Stork

Dine on fresh seafood at Restaurant Stork, a trendy spot known for its industrial vibe and delicious fish dishes, open from 5pm to 10pm.
EUR35, 1h30m

Day 2: Neighborhood Charm

Amsterdam, Netherlands on April 20, 2025

8:00am

Breakfast at Bakers & Roasters

Enjoy a hearty brunch-style breakfast with coffee and fresh juices at Bakers & Roasters, a popular café in De Pijp neighborhood open from 8am.
EUR15, 1h

9:30am

Albert Cuyp Market Visit

Browse the vibrant Albert Cuyp Market, open daily from 9am to 5pm, where you can find local treats, fresh produce, and unique souvenirs.
Free entry, 1h

11:00am

Stedelijk Museum Amsterdam

Immerse yourself in modern and contemporary art at the Stedelijk Museum, open from 10am to 6pm, featuring works by Dutch and international artists.
EUR20, 1h30m

1:00pm

Lunch at Foodhallen

Taste diverse street food from multiple vendors under one roof at Foodhallen, a lively indoor food market in De Pijp open daily from 12pm.
EUR20, 1h

2:30pm

Anne Frank House

Visit the Anne Frank House museum for a moving and historical experience; tickets must be booked in advance, and it’s open from 9am to 7pm.
EUR14, 1h30m

4:15pm

Explore Nine Streets (Negen Straatjes)

Wander the Nine Streets area filled with boutique shops, artisan stores, and cozy cafés—ideal for some last-minute shopping and people-watching.
Free, 1h

6:30pm

Dinner at De Kas

End your Amsterdam stay with a memorable farm-to-table dining experience at De Kas, set in a greenhouse serving seasonal Dutch dishes, open until 10pm.
EUR50, 2h
